A former Michigan State football player is in hot water this weekend after being arrested over the weekend.

Zion Young, a former Michigan State defensive end from the Mel Tucker era, was reportedly arrested on Saturday on suspicion of a DWI (driving while intoxicated) and speeding.

Young has reportedly been released and Missouri is aware of the arrest. Head coach Eli Drinkwitz said that he holds his student-athletes to the highest standard and they’re evaluating the situation and next steps.
